Are Ryu and Ken related?

Are Ryu and Ken related?

Ken Masters (ケン・マスターズ, Ken Masutāzu), originally spelled in kanji as Ken (拳, Fist) with his original full name being unknown, is a fictional character in Capcom’s Street Fighter series. Ken is the best friend and rival of Ryu, who has also appeared in all Street Fighter games.

Who did Ken Masters marry?

Eliza
Eliza is a NPC character in the Street Fighter series of fighting games. She is the wife of Ken Masters, and the sister-in-law of Guile (as he’s married to her older sister Julia).

When did Street Fighter 5 come out?

Street Fighter V. Street Fighter V is a fighting video game developed by Capcom and Dimps. The game was released in February 2016 for the PlayStation 4 and Microsoft Windows.

Does Ken fight Ryu in Street Fighter 2?

After the events of Street Fighter II, Ken is married to Eliza, something he had apparently vowed only to do after winning a decisive victory against Ryu. However, it is unknown if the two fought during the tournament or if Ken actually won if they even did. No details have been stated.
